Comprehending Rotary Sprinklers for Optimal Lawn Coverage
When it comes to irrigating your lawn effectively, rotary sprinklers stand out as a reliable choice. These sprinklers utilize a rotating head to distribute water in a round pattern, ensuring thorough coverage across your lawn. To enhance the performance of your rotary sprinklers and achieve that vibrant lawn you wish, understanding their functionality is crucial.
- Initially, modify the sprinkler's angle to match your lawn's shape and size. This prevents overlap or gaps in coverage, ensuring consistent watering across the entire area.
- Next, factor in your lawn's composition. Different soils absorb water at different rates, so you may need to adjust the sprinkler's watering duration accordingly.
- Conclusively, periodically inspect your rotary sprinklers for any malfunctions. This encompasses checking the sprinkler head, spray tips and connections for leaks or blockages.
Via following these recommendations, you can confirm that your rotary sprinklers are operating at their best, delivering optimal lawn coverage and contributing to a healthy, thriving landscape.

Preserving Your Rotary Sprinkler System: Tips & Tricks
A well-maintained rotary sprinkler system is crucial for a lush and vibrant lawn. Periodically examining your system can pinpoint potential issues before they become problematic. Begin with visual inspections of the sprinkler heads, looking for any clogging. Scrub out clogged nozzles with a needle. Adjust the spray pattern as required to ensure even coverage.
- Test your system bi-weekly during the growing season to monitor water pressure and performance
- Check for any leaks in hoses, connections, or sprinkler heads. Repair any issues promptly.
- Prepare your system after the colder months to prevent damage from freezing temperatures.
Don't forget that a well-maintained rotary sprinkler system will not only reduce water consumption but also enhance vitality of your lawn.
